05 2019 档案

摘要:"我是抄题解狂魔" cpp / 1.s.substr(x,len) 在s中取出从x位置开始,长度为len的字符串,并返回string类型的字符串。 2.s.find(a) 在s中查找字符串a,并返回起始下标(从0开始),若不存在,返回1844674407370955161,即(19999999999 阅读全文
posted @ 2019-05-23 21:25 蟹蟹王 阅读(180) 评论(0) 推荐(0)
摘要:关于归并排序求逆序对: cpp include include using namespace std; long long n,a[500005],ans=0; long long f[500005]; void merge_sort(long long l,long long r) { if(l 阅读全文
posted @ 2019-05-23 21:22 蟹蟹王 阅读(139) 评论(0) 推荐(0)
摘要:"题目传送门" "大佬的博客" 对于一个节点来说,当它所有的食物的LCA灭绝时,它才会灭绝。因此,将它直接连向这个LCA。然后有向图就变成了一棵树,每个节点的子树的大小 1就是该节点的答案。 cpp include include include include using namespace st 阅读全文
posted @ 2019-05-21 20:26 蟹蟹王 阅读(154) 评论(0) 推荐(0)
摘要:"最坑的一道二分题" 巧克力要全部吃完,余下的巧克力默认放在最后一天吃。 $check$ 函数写得不够熟练啊!!! 继续努力。 cpp include include include define LL long long define mid ((l+r) 1) using namespace s 阅读全文
posted @ 2019-05-16 20:12 蟹蟹王 阅读(142) 评论(0) 推荐(0)
摘要:"题目传送门" 借鉴的大佬的博客 "这儿" 个人认为我的解释更详细一些 先来看部分分 $1.$25分 (当然是大暴力了!) $2.$一条链 首先,要考虑到它有左往右和从右往左两种情况 这里只讨论从左往右的情况,从右往左类似。 若第$i$条路径对$u$点有贡献,当且仅当$dep[u]=dep[si]+ 阅读全文
posted @ 2019-05-14 21:16 蟹蟹王 阅读(253) 评论(0) 推荐(1)
摘要:"绿题好难啊" luoguP1687 。。。。注释写在代码里了。 既然是求最小的天数,应该以天数作为DP值,剩下的变量里挑选合适的作为数组下表(数据范围可能会有提示) : 第一层循环是选到了第i个物品,当前是第i个物品。那么到当前的dp[i][]就是对于前i个物品的答案。 对于一个当前的i,它指我们 阅读全文
posted @ 2019-05-07 20:10 蟹蟹王 阅读(264) 评论(0) 推荐(1)
摘要:"搜索+DP" 思路还是有一点点问题的。就是关于当前枚举的邮票的面值所能构成的最大值的求解: 假如最大的面值为$k$,那么$maxx$达不到$k$,不一定不合法,不能直接$return $。 大体思路: $dfs$每张邮票的面值, 求出当前邮票所能构成的最大值(不是直接$max k$) ,这里用DP 阅读全文
posted @ 2019-05-04 20:42 蟹蟹王 阅读(349) 评论(0) 推荐(0)
摘要:省选Day2T2 自己的思路: 将树上所有的链存到好几个数组里,每次取出每个数组的最大值比较,将最大的计入答案。其实很接近正解了。 . 正解:将每个点的子树合成一个堆,启发式合并(由小到大)。 上代码吧 cpp include include include include define LL lo 阅读全文
posted @ 2019-05-03 22:24 蟹蟹王 阅读(292) 评论(0) 推荐(0)
摘要:NOIP2015 T1跳石头 二分,没啥好说的,不知道为啥$n=0,k=0$的特殊数据会错。 T2子串 $f[i][j][p][0/1]$表示$a$串到第$i$个字符,$b$串匹配到第$j$个字符,一共划分成$p$部分,第$i$个字符用$(1)$没用$(0)$的方案数。 $if(a[i]==b[j] 阅读全文
posted @ 2019-05-03 15:08 蟹蟹王 阅读(128) 评论(0) 推荐(0)
摘要:"当然还是洛谷的题啦" 首先 自己的思路: 知识点:装满的01背包($f[0]=0$,其他的赋值为$ inf$) 获得了70分的好成绩 很明显,$sum$会达到$1e9$,当然会超时了,想了想也不会优化。 于是开心地看了题解。 然后 定义$x[i]=0/1$表示选不选第i头牛。则要求最大的$ans$ 阅读全文
posted @ 2019-05-03 14:39 蟹蟹王 阅读(468) 评论(0) 推荐(0)